My Arduino based alarm clock is making some progress. This weekend, I soldered together the DCF77 receiver and gave it a spin. It works remarkably well. I'm pretty confident that I can omit an RTC because the Arduino has "okay-ish" timekeeping functionality and the DCF77 signal is just brilliant. This leaves me with two big tasks: o Sound. The Arduino Uno can play basic tones but I'd rather have a sophisticated, dedicated sound processor. o A real "boxing". Right now, everything exists only on a breadboard.
